You think it's the balance, but consider that the more strength you have, the less balance you need. For example with more forearm strength you will be able to lean further onto your fingertips. With more shoulder, arm, and abdominal strength, starting from a handstand position you will be able to pivot at your shoulders and bend all the way down to a planche position. So work on your strength, and handstands will become a lot easier.
